Neuer Defies Age at 40, Returns as Germany's #1 for 2026 World Cup
Soccer May 21, 2026 2 min read

Neuer Defies Age at 40, Returns as Germany's #1 for 2026 World Cup

The Bayern Munich legend ends his international retirement to reclaim Germany's gloves for what could be his final World Cup dance.

Manuel Neuer has pulled off perhaps the most audacious comeback in modern football, emerging from international retirement at age 40 to secure Germany's number one spot for the 2026 World Cup. The Bayern Munich shot-stopper's return sends shockwaves through the football world, proving that class and experience can triumph over Father Time.

Manager Julian Nagelsmann didn't mince words when announcing his squad, declaring Neuer will be his undisputed first choice between the sticks. This marks a stunning reversal for a goalkeeper many thought had hung up his international gloves for good, but Neuer's hunger for one final World Cup adventure clearly burned too bright to ignore.

Germany's squad selection comes as African nations continue building momentum on the global stage, with powerhouses like Morocco, Senegal, and Nigeria expected to field their strongest-ever World Cup lineups. The 2026 tournament promises to be a fascinating clash between European experience and Africa's rising generation of superstars.

For Neuer, this represents the ultimate career capstone - a chance to add World Cup glory to his already legendary résumé. At 40, he'll be one of the oldest players at the tournament, but if his recent Bayern performances are any indication, age is just a number for this German giant. The 2026 World Cup just became infinitely more intriguing.
